NewYork-Presbyterian/Morgan Stanley Children's Hospital and The Sloane Hospital for Women Celebrate Exceptional Patient Care at the Annual Amazing Kids, Amazing Care Dinner

Over $675,000 Raised for NewYork-Presbyterian/Morgan Stanley Children’s Hospital and the Sloane Hospital for Women in addition to a $5 Million Gift Received for new Infant Cardiac Unit

Nov 4, 2016

New York

a group of people posing for a photo

NewYork-Presbyterian/Morgan Stanley Children’s Hospital and the Sloane Hospital for Women, along with journalist and television host Meredith Vieira, held its annual Amazing Kids, Amazing Care Dinner on Wednesday, November 2, at the JW Marriott Essex House in Manhattan to celebrate the extraordinary care the Hospital provides for pediatric patients and their families. NewYork-Presbyterian Trustee and Hearst CEO Steven R. Swartz, and his wife Tina, served as Trustee Chairs of the evening’s event which raised over $675,000 in support of both NewYork-Presbyterian/Morgan Stanley Children’s Hospital and the Sloane Hospital for Women, which provides care for women and children.

Vieira, who acted as the event’s celebrity emcee, and Dr. Steven J. Corwin, President and Chief Executive Officer of NewYork-Presbyterian were joined by 320 guests. Previously known as the “Birthday Bash,” this is the 4th year NewYork-Presbyterian has celebrated the world-class and compassionate care it provides for families and children. This year, the Sloane Hospital for Women and NewYork-Presbyterian/Morgan Stanley Children’s Hospital were celebrated at the event for their collaboration in caring for high–risk expectant mothers and critically ill newborns.

During the event, a $5,000,000 gift was announced from the grandchildren of Vivian and the late Seymour Milstein to name the new Infant Cardiac Unit at NewYork-Presbyterian/Morgan Stanley Children’s Hospital. Toby Milstein spoke at the dinner representing the grandchildren, and remarked “we came together to continue our family’s legacy of supporting the Hospital. Heart health is very important to our family and for the next generation of the Milstein Family to be able to help the next generation of patients is heartwarming.” Their gift will help create a new 17-bed infant cardiac unit to care for the youngest and most vulnerable patients. The Infant Cardiac Unit is set to open in June of 2017.

A leader in research and patient care since it was established as the Babies Hospital in 1887, NewYork-Presbyterian/Morgan Stanley Children’s Hospital opened in 2003 as an innovative facility with critical and neonatal intensive care facilities, providing the highest quality care for pediatric patients from around the region. NewYork-Presbyterian Hospital is ranked in 10 pediatric specialties in the 2015-16 U.S. News & World Report “Best Children's Hospitals” survey — more than any other children’s hospital in the New York metropolitan area.

When it opened in 1887, the Sloane Hospital for Women was the first hospital in New York solely devoted to women’s healthcare. Its innovative treatments linked obstetrics to gynecology, and it quickly developed a reputation for exceptional patient care and low mortality rates. Now a part of NewYork-Presbyterian/Columbia University Irving Medical Center, The Sloane Hospital for Women brings together a vast spectrum of specialists, resources and programs uniquely designed to meet the health needs of women throughout their lives.
